Bitcoin ETF Options Trading Gets Approval from NYSE and CBOE

The cryptocurrency landscape is buzzing with excitement following a significant regulatory approval from the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The SEC has authorized the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E) and the Chicago Board Options Exchange (CBOE) to begin trading options on various spot Bitcoin Exchange-Traded Funds (ETFs). This move is poised to reshape the market dynamics for Bitcoin and attract a wave of institutional investors.
Understanding the Approval
On October 18, 2024, the SEC confirmed its decision to allow both exchanges to facilitate options trading. The NYSE, being the largest stock exchange by market capitalization, will provide options for 11 different spot Bitcoin ETFs. This includes notable products like the iShares Bitcoin Trust (IBIT), Franklin Bitcoin ETF (EZBC), and Grayscale Bitcoin Trust (GBTC).
The CBOE is also set to list options on 10 spot Bitcoin ETFs, excluding the Grayscale Bitcoin Mini Trust. This is a crucial step for these exchanges, enabling them to expand their offerings and increase liquidity in the cryptocurrency market.
What Are Options and Why Do They Matter?
Options trading allows investors to buy or sell an underlying asset at a predetermined price within a specified timeframe. This trading mechanism provides investors with the flexibility to hedge against price movements, making it an attractive option for those looking to manage risk in their portfolios.
The SEC believes that introducing options for Bitcoin ETFs will improve liquidity and facilitate better hedging strategies. This could significantly enhance investor confidence, particularly among institutional players who often seek stable environments for their investments.
Impact on the Bitcoin Market
Since the approval of Bitcoin ETFs, the market has witnessed remarkable growth, with cumulative net inflows exceeding $20 billion. Bitcoin ETFs now hold around 4.89% of the circulating Bitcoin supply. This trend is expected to continue as more investors gain access to these financial products.
Analysts speculate that the ability to trade options will further boost Bitcoin’s popularity. As institutional investors seek opportunities to capitalize on Bitcoin’s price movements, options contracts may provide the necessary tools to do so. The influx of institutional capital could lead to increased volatility and potentially higher prices for Bitcoin.
What Comes Next?
With the SEC’s approval, the next steps involve ensuring compliance with additional regulatory bodies, including the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C). While the SEC’s approval is a major milestone, successful listing will also depend on the CFTC’s green light.
Bloomberg’s senior analyst Eric Balchunas noted that the approval was expected, drawing parallels with Nasdaq’s recent regulatory win. He emphasized that while the process is progressing smoothly, a definitive listing date for the options contracts has yet to be established.
